Enemies among Us. The Relocation, Internment, and Repatriation of German, Italian, and Japanese Americans during the Second World War, Paperback/John E. Schmitz
John E. Schmitz examines the causes, conditions, and consequences of America’s selective relocation and internment of German, Italian, and Japanese Americans during World War II.
